Food borne illnesses are caused by consuming contaminated foods or beverages. There are many different disease-causing microbes, or pathogens. In addition, poisonous chemicals, or other harmful substances can cause food borne illnesses if they are present in food. More than two hundred and fifty different food borne illnesses have been described; almost all of these illnesses are infections. They are caused by a variety of bacteria, viruses, and parasites that can be food borne. Food safety is an increasingly important public health issue. Governments all over the world are intensifying their efforts to improve food safety. Although their incidence is relatively low, their severe and sometimes fatal health consequences, particularly among infants, children, and the elderly.  Calicivirus or Norwalk virus is an extremely common cause of foodborne illness, though it is rarely diagnosed, because the laboratory test is not widely available. It causes an acute gastrointestinal illness, usually with more vomiting than diarrhea that resolves within two days. Unlike many food borne pathogens that have animal reservoirs, it is believed that Norwalk viruses spread primarily from one infected person to another. Infected kitchen workers can contaminate a salad or sandwich, which they are preparing, if the virus is present on the hands. Salmonella is a bacteria that causes an infection known as Salmonellosis. A person that is infected with Salmonella gets diarrhea, fever, and abdominal cramps 12 to 72 hours after being infected. Salmonella usually last four to seven days and most people recover without treatment. People with severe diarrhea must be hospitalized.  The Salmonella can spread in from the intestines to the bloodstream and other parts of the body and can cause death of not treated quickly with antibiotics. Identify a windblown sedimentary deposit, which is buff or yellowish brown in color and erodes easily.
Y_Kistochka [10]
A wind blown sedimentary deposit, which is buff or yellowish brown in color and erodes easily is called LOESS.
Loess is a loosely compacted yellowish deposit of wind blown sediment; an extensive deposits of loess is found in China. Loess is homogeneous and porous.
